Types of Crop Protection Solutions
Insecticides
Insecticides protect crops from harmful insects that feed on
leaves, stems, roots, and fruits. They are widely used in crops such as cotton,
rice, vegetables, pulses, and fruits. Choosing the right insecticide at the
correct crop stage helps reduce pest populations while protecting beneficial
insects whenever possible.
Fungicides
Fungicides are essential for controlling fungal diseases
such as leaf spot, blight, rust, mildew, and anthracnose. They can be
preventive or curative and are commonly used in cereals, vegetables,
horticultural crops, and plantations. Timely application plays a crucial role
in effective disease management.
Herbicides
Weeds compete with crops for water, sunlight, nutrients, and
space. Herbicides help eliminate unwanted weeds, allowing crops to grow more
efficiently. Proper weed management improves crop establishment, increases
yields, and reduces manual labor costs.
Biopesticides
Biopesticides are environmentally friendly crop protection
products developed from natural organisms or plant-based materials. They
support sustainable agriculture by controlling pests while minimizing
environmental impact and preserving beneficial insects.
The Importance of Integrated Pest Management (IPM)
Integrated Pest Management (IPM) combines biological,
cultural, mechanical, and chemical methods to manage pests effectively. Instead
of depending solely on pesticides, IPM encourages regular crop monitoring,
early pest identification, crop rotation, resistant crop varieties, and
responsible pesticide management.
Using fungicides, herbicides, and insecticides only when
necessary helps reduce resistance development and supports long-term crop
health. IPM not only protects crops but also promotes environmental
sustainability and cost-effective farming.
Choosing the Right Crop Protection Product
Selecting the right crop protection product depends on
several important factors:
- Identify
the pest, weed, or disease correctly.
- Consider
the crop type and growth stage.
- Evaluate
weather conditions before application.
- Rotate
products to reduce resistance.
- Purchase
products from trusted and registered manufacturers.
Farmers should always read product labels carefully and
follow the recommended dosage and application schedule. Buying from reputable
companies ensures product quality, safety, and regulatory compliance.
Safe Handling and Application Tips
Safe pesticide management protects both farmers and the
environment. Always wear protective clothing, gloves, masks, and eye protection
during mixing and spraying. Apply products during calm weather to minimize
spray drift and achieve better coverage.
Use calibrated spraying equipment, avoid excessive
application, and never mix products unless recommended on the label. Empty
containers should be disposed of according to CIB&RC guidelines, and
crop protection products should always be stored away from food, water sources,
children, and livestock.
